IP Country City ISP
31.200.249.162 Russia Start LLC
85.85.129.165 Spain San Sebastian Euskaltel S.A.
89.131.33.48 Spain Pamplona Orange Espana
93.156.217.213 Spain Oviedo R Cable y Telecable Telecomunicaciones, S.A.U.